Council approves minutes and January financials; sets committees and Ackerman ribbon cutting

Village of Fredericktown Council · February 16, 2026

Summary

Council corrected and approved Feb. 2 minutes, approved January bills and bank reconciliation, set committee meeting dates for March 16, and announced an Ackerman Nature Preserve ribbon cutting for June 13. The meeting adjourned at 7:39 p.m.

Council Member Cline noted that the Feb. 2 minutes did not reflect his vote in favor of Resolution No. 2026-04; Council Member Brewer moved to approve the Feb. 2 minutes with that correction, Pugh seconded, and the motion passed unanimously. "Cline noted that he did vote in favor of passing Resolution No. 2026-04, but it was not marked as so," the minutes record.

Fiscal Officer Suzan Graves presented the bills, financial reports and the January 2026 bank reconciliation; Brewer moved to approve the financial reports, bills and bank statement for January 2026, McKnight seconded, and the motion passed unanimously. Council also noted committee meeting dates (Safety, Public Works and Finance committees meet March 16) and announced an Ackerman Nature Preserve ribbon cutting scheduled for June 13 at 10:00 a.m. Cline moved to adjourn, Shoemaker seconded, and the meeting concluded at 7:39 p.m.
